Subjuncdtive Form.

QuestionAnswer
How does one form the present subjunctive in French? For regular verbs, drop the -ent ending from the present tense form of the verb and add the subjunctive endings.
What are the subjunctive endings? -e, -es, -e, -ions, -iez, -ent
je (parler) je parle
tu (parler) tu parles
il/elle (parler) il/elle parle
nous (parler) nous parlions
vous (parler) vous parliez
ils/elles (parler) ils/elles parlent
je (finir) je finisse
tu (finir) tu finisses
il/elle (finir) il/elle finisse
nous (finir) nous finissions
vous (finir) vous finissiez
ils/elles (finir) ils/elles finissent
je (attendre) j'attende
tu (attendre) tu attendes
il/elle (attendre) il/elle attende
nous (attendre) nous attendions
vous (attendre) vous attendiez
ils/elles (attendre) ils/elles attendent
stem for verb acheter achèt, achet
stem for croire croi, croy
stem for prendre prenn, pren
stem for recevoir reçoiv, recev
je (aller) j'aille
tu (aller) tu ailles
il/elle (aller) il/elle aille
nous (aller) nous allions
vous (aller) vous alliez
ils/elles (aller) ils/elles aillent
je (avoir) j'aie
tu (avoir) tu aies
il/elle (avoir) il/elle ait
nous (avoir) nous ayons
vous (avoir) vous ayez
ils/elles (avoir) aient
je (être) je sois
tu (être) tu sois
il/elle (être) il/elle soit
nous (être) nous soyons
vous (être) vous soyez
ils/elles (être) ils/elles soient
je (faire) je fasse
tu (faire) tu fasses
il/elle (faire) il/elle fasse
nous (faire) nous fassions
vous (faire) vous fassiez
ils/elles (faire) ils/elles fassent
je (pouvoir) je puisse
tu (pouvoir) tu puisses
il/elle (pouvoir) il/elle puisse
nous (pouvoir) nous puissions
vous (pouvoir) vous puissiez
ils/elles (pouvoir) ils/elles puissent
je (vouloir) je veuille
tu (vouloir) tu veuilles
il/elle (vouloir) il/elle veuille
nous (vouloir) nous voulions
vous (vouloir) vous vouliez
ils/elles (vouloir) ils/elles veuillent
je (savoir) je sache
tu (savoir) tu saches
il/elle (savoir) il/elle sache
nous (savoir) nous sachions
vous (savoir) vous sachiez
ils/elles (savoir) ils/elles sachent
Ce n'est pas la peine que It's not worth the effort that...
Il est bon que... It's good that...
Il est dommage que... It's too bad that...
Il est essentiel que... It's essential that...
Il est étonnant que... It's surprising that...
Il est important que... It is important that...
Il est indispensable que... It is indispensable that...
It est nécessaire que... It is necessary that...
Il est possible que... It is possible that...
Il est surprenant que... It is surprising that...
Il faut que... It is necessary that, One must...
Il vaut mieux que... It's better that...
demander que... to ask that...
désirer que... to desire that...
exiger que... to demand that...
préférer que... to prefer that...
proposer que... to propose that...
recommander que... to recommend that...
souhaiter que... to hope that...
suggérer que.. to suggest that...
vouloir que... to want that...
aimer que... to like that...
avoir peur que... to be afraid that...
être content(e) que... to be happy that...
être désolé(e) que... to be sorry that...
être étonné(e) que... to be surprised that...
être faché(e) que... to be mad that...
être fier/fière que... to be proud that...
être ravi(e) que... to be delighted that...
regretter que... to regret that...
